Fleshy Leaf 2.5″ SSD HDD Caddy Bracket for ASUS TUF
Those upgrading an ASUS TUF Gaming F15 with a second storage drive need this caddy bracket to replace the laptop’s original 2.5″ hard drive bay. The package includes a hard drive cable, caddy bracket, two rubber rails, and four screws. You’ll install a 2.5″ SATA SSD or HDD up to 7.0 mm thick. Before purchasing, verify the part number matches your specific model—F15 FX506, A15, FA506, FA506IV, FA506IU, or FA706. Contact the seller if you need clarification on compatibility. Once installed, you’ll double your storage capacity without replacing your primary drive.

Form Factor And Compatibility
What’s the first thing you need to know before buying an SSD for your ASUS TUF F15? You must verify the form factor. Your laptop requires an M.2 2280 drive—that’s 22mm wide and 80mm long. This size fits your drive bay properly. Next, confirm the drive uses NVMe, not SATA, since NVMe delivers the performance you need. Choose either PCIe Gen3 x4 or Gen4 x4 for optimal speed and compatibility. Before purchasing, check your drive’s height: some 7mm and 9.5mm drives won’t fit depending on your specific TUF F15 configuration. Finally, if you’re considering newer Gen4 drives, verify your BIOS supports them. Checking these compatibility points prevents buying incompatible hardware.

Storage Capacity Requirements
How much storage capacity do you actually need for your ASUS TUF F15? Start by counting your AAA games and large media files. If you’re a casual user storing only the OS and applications, 512 GB works, though you’ll manage space frequently. For most gamers, 1 TB strikes the right balance between capacity and cost, accommodating multiple AAA titles without constant deletions. If you maintain an extensive game library or work with 4K video projects, choose 2 TB to avoid regular reorganization. Plan ahead by selecting a drive with extra headroom beyond your immediate needs. This approach prevents you from outgrowing your storage within months and minimizes future upgrade costs.

Durability And Warranty Coverage
What separates a solid SSD investment from a risky one? Warranty coverage and durability metrics. Check the manufacturer’s MTBF rating—aim for drives rated 1.5 million hours or higher. Next, verify the warranty period; five-year warranties indicate stronger confidence than shorter terms. Review what failures the warranty actually covers, as coverage varies by manufacturer. Look at TBW ratings, which measure total bytes written before failure; gaming workloads demand drives rated 300+ TBW. Examine heat tolerance specifications since the TUF F15 generates sustained thermal load. Finally, confirm the drive has no moving parts and meets shock resistance standards. Cross-reference these metrics across your top candidates before purchasing to ensure your upgrade survives years of intensive gaming and daily use.
